There is a reason you can't do that! That's the whole point of file-permissions. You need to be root to write files into /usr/lib.

If you are NOT root, then you can't write to /usr/lib, that's it! This is called "file protection", and most OS's have it. It's there so that normal user's can't mess the system up.
